If you like clay packs, you should try it once. I bought it on sale at Lohbs along with a beer pack. After the pack, I felt refreshed. It's like a small amount of toothpaste or ointment was applied.
ConsIt was very stuffy. Unlike the clay pack, which is like putting clay on, the rubber pack doesn't dry out or pull. This is mud, so it pulls and is stuffy. The skin is covered in a stuffy way, but as it dries, I'm not sure if it's convenient. They say the effect is better if you do it for more than 30 minutes, but I almost suffocated. It's much better to just spread a mud pack. And is it really effective for exfoliating? I'm not sure about sebum removal either. The next day, my skin texture was rough and I didn't wear makeup. The area where the wedge puff passed was expressed smoothly, but the rough skin that the puff couldn't cover seemed to have absorbed the moisture. It doesn't suit dry skin.
TipThe effect of this pack is not moisturizing, but the exfoliating effect is also mild, so I recommend that you apply a moisturizing cream and do the pack. If you want to fill in more than 30 minutes, 40 minutes would be better. It pulls a lot.
